Responsibilities

  • Maintain accurate inventory records for raw materials, WIP (work-in-progress), and finished goods.
  • Monitor stock levels and initiate replenishment orders to avoid shortages or overstock.
  • Conduct regular cycle counts and reconcile discrepancies.
  • Collaborate with fabrication and procurement teams to forecast material needs.
  • Plan and schedule inbound and outbound shipments for fabrication materials and finished products.
  • Coordinate with carriers, suppliers, and internal teams to ensure timely deliveries and pickups.
  • Prepare shipping documentation, including BOLs, packing lists, and labels.
  • Track shipments and resolve any transportation issues or delays.
  • Support fabrication floor with timely delivery of materials and removal of completed parts.
  • Ensure proper storage, labeling, and handling of materials in compliance with safety and quality standards.
  • Assist in continuous improvement initiatives related to inventory accuracy and logistics efficiency.
